hmm, there is room for a Quad,...

this has been on back-burner, since I've not seen too many riders want
the mega.
my quad starts at 2600 lumen ,
and can push it to 3400.
the thing is everything becomes mega,...
talking about 40W+ , needs new battery, new charger, and cooling.
I mean, the betty has some oomp, but throttles down quick, since it gets hot,
so it does not throw, 1850 lumen after 5-10 minutes,...
do have one custom machined housing lying around, round similar size and weight like the betty, what could push 3200 lumen .
the other one is more , industrial design . these might cost more than a betty,...

Hi Woody, i'm also running the Betty2/Wilma combo like BBW. I'ts nice to see i'm not the only one who keeps upgrading even though were already riding with more than enough light lol.Your Wilma/Piko combo already is a kick-a#@ set up.Yes, upgrading to the Betty2 will be a big change over your exsisting set up.The betty2 is brighter than the Wilma but does not have more throw.I went out on a ride with two Betty2's the other day and by the end of the ride, that set up didn't seem brighter than my Betty/Wilma.What i think is happening,is once you get to a certain level of brightness you eyes adjust, just like taking video.Not sure what kind of output improvments the XM-Lamp emitters are going to give Lupine's familly,but they would need to be significant for a wow factor as 2950 lumens is pretty much as much your eyes can handle within 25 yards.

So,i would conclude Woody,,,,,GO FOR IT!!! If you can afford it,the output will be significant. Once there,,you will alway's have the option of upgrading with the next best LED's.Cheers!!!:thumbsup:
